yield 12 serving(s)
prep time 30 Min
cook time 30 Min

Ingredients For little bites of heaven

  • 1 qt
    (30 oz ) frozen country style shredded hashbrown potatoes
  • 2 c
    shredded 4-cheese mexican blend cheese
  • 16 oz
    microwave bacon, black label crumbled
  • 3 Tbsp
    melted butter
  • 1/8 tsp
    salt
  • 1/8 tsp
    pepper
  • 6
    eggs
  • 1 Tbsp
    chopped fresh chives or green onions
  • 1/4 c
    cup chopped red bell pepper

How To Make little bites of heaven

  • 1
    1.Pre-heat oven to 400°F .2.In a bowl, combine the hash browns, butter, salt, and pepper. Press mixture onto the bottom and up the sides of the greased non-stick muffin cups. Bake at 400°F for 12 minutes or until lightly browned. .3.Meanwhile, cook sausage according to package directions; cut into 1/2-inch pieces. Divide sausage among muffin cups. .4.Combine the eggs, cheese and bell pepper. Spoon over sausage. Sprinkle with chives. Bake for 13-15 minutes or until set and an internal temperature of 165°F has been reached.
  • 2
    You can also use sausage .
